Alleged gay basher found as music community rallies behind the victim

The individual alleged to have gay bashed a Johannesburg man at the Grietfest music festival on Saturday has reportedly been tracked down. Hairstylist Brandon Swanepoel, 34, says he was attacked simply because he was dancing with another man at the event. Case delayed as activists demand justice for lesbian hate crime victim Lerato Tambai Moloi

A group of activists demonstrated outside the Protea Magistrate’s Court in Soweto on Wednesday to demand justice for slain lesbian Lerato Tambai Moloi. Olympic veteran comes out – feared his sexuality being “sensationalised” (watch)

British athletics Olympian Colin Jackson has confirmed that he is gay in an interview on Swedish television. Jackson, 50, who competed in sprint and hurdling, won a silver medal in the 1988 Summer Olympics and was crowned world champion twice. Gay & Lesbian Network condemns threats against Inxeba (The Wound)

After seeing the film, members of the Gay & Lesbian Network (GLN) say threats against the controversial Inxeba (The Wound) are unjustified, hateful and misdirected. Somizi & Bonang | The battle of the books hots up

Somizi Mhlongo is threatening legal action if former friend Bonang Matheba does not remove references about him from her controversial biography. Despite fears of arrest, LGBT community holds secret Pride Uganda party

In defiance of the recent cancellation of Pride Uganda, activists and members of the country’s LGBT community held a secret celebration asserting their identity and rights. Joy as Soweto Pride set to return after 2016 “coerced” cancellation

Soweto Pride, one of the most significant and historic LGBTI events in South Africa, will return on 30 September, following last year’s shock cancellation.
